Scalables is launching an Early Adopter Program designed to foster deep collaboration between our engineering team and the research community. This program offers academic institutions, core facilities, and industry R&D labs the opportunity to access the latest Daisy platform modules at significantly reduced pricing in exchange for detailed feedback on performance, usability, and application fit. Early adopters play a critical role in shaping the future of the platform by identifying real-world use cases and suggesting feature enhancements that benefit the entire user community.

Benefits for Participating Institutions

Participants in the Early Adopter Program receive several exclusive benefits beyond discounted hardware pricing. These include priority access to new module releases before general availability, direct communication channels with our product development team, co-authorship opportunities on application notes and case studies, and complimentary extended warranty coverage. For academic labs, the program also provides documentation suitable for grant applications, demonstrating institutional partnerships that funding agencies view favorably. Industry participants benefit from early integration testing that can accelerate their own product development timelines.
